Protein name | RecName: Full=Coproheme decarboxylase; EC=1.3.98.5; AltName: Full=Coproheme III oxidative decarboxylase; AltName: Full=Hydrogen peroxide-dependent heme synthase; |
Gene name | Name=chdC; |
Comments
[?]
FUNCTION | Involved in coproporphyrin-dependent heme b biosynthesis. Catalyzes the decarboxylation of Fe-coproporphyrin III (coproheme) to heme b (protoheme IX), the last step of the pathway. The reaction occurs in a stepwise manner with a three-propionate intermediate. |
CATALYTIC ACTIVITY | Reaction=Fe-coproporphyrin III + 2 H(+) + 2 H2O2 = 2 CO2 + 4 H2O + heme b; Xref=Rhea:RHEA:56516, ChEBI:CHEBI:15377, ChEBI:CHEBI:15378, ChEBI:CHEBI:16240, ChEBI:CHEBI:16526, ChEBI:CHEBI:60344, ChEBI:CHEBI:68438; EC=1.3.98.5; PhysiologicalDirection=left-to-right; Xref=Rhea:RHEA:56517; |
CATALYTIC ACTIVITY | Reaction=Fe-coproporphyrin III + H(+) + H2O2 = CO2 + 2 H2O + harderoheme III; Xref=Rhea:RHEA:57940, ChEBI:CHEBI:15377, ChEBI:CHEBI:15378, ChEBI:CHEBI:16240, ChEBI:CHEBI:16526, ChEBI:CHEBI:68438, ChEBI:CHEBI:142463; PhysiologicalDirection=left-to-right; Xref=Rhea:RHEA:57941; |
CATALYTIC ACTIVITY | Reaction=H(+) + H2O2 + harderoheme III = CO2 + 2 H2O + heme b; Xref=Rhea:RHEA:57944, ChEBI:CHEBI:15377, ChEBI:CHEBI:15378, ChEBI:CHEBI:16240, ChEBI:CHEBI:16526, ChEBI:CHEBI:60344, ChEBI:CHEBI:142463; PhysiologicalDirection=left-to-right; Xref=Rhea:RHEA:57945; |
COFACTOR | Name=Fe-coproporphyrin III; Xref=ChEBI:CHEBI:68438; Note=Fe-coproporphyrin III acts as both substrate and redox cofactor; |
PATHWAY | Porphyrin-containing compound metabolism; protoheme biosynthesis. |
SIMILARITY | Belongs to the ChdC family. Type 1 subfamily. |
